At McGowan, Hood, Felder & Phillips, LLC, Anna focuses her practice on representing individuals in medical malpractice, personal injury suits, class actions, consumer fraud cases and insurance bad faith cases. Anna was born and raised in Georgia and Alabama. She went to college at Lenoir-Rhyne College in Hickory, North Carolina, and then attended the University of South Carolina School of Law. While at the University of South Carolina, Anna was on the dean's list and a representative for the Student Bar Association. After graduation, she settled in the Myrtle Beach area where she met her husband, John. Before joining McGowan, Hood, Felder & Phillips, LLC, she worked as an associate with Rice, MacDonald & Hicks, P.A. for seven years, focusing mainly on civil litigation, collections and homeowners associations. In her spare time Anna enjoys the beach, Gamecock Football, and spending time with her husband and children, MaryHope, Andy and Wally. Anna is a member of the Georgetown County Bar Association, South Carolina Bar Association, the American Association for Justice and the South Carolina Trial Lawyers Association.

Ashley was born and raised in Spartanburg, South Carolina. She attended college at Elon University in Burlington, NC, where she graduated in the top 8 of her class. She then attended the University of South Carolina School of Law, where she met her husband Drew. While at the University of South Carolina, Ashley was Senior Articles Editor of the ABA Real Property Probate and Trust Journal, a member of the Moot Court bar, and Order of the Wig and Robe. Ashley has successfully represented clients through trial during the last ten years, and assisted in reaching several of the highest reported settlements in South Carolina in 2013 and 2014. She handles all aspects of her clients' cases and has presented oral arguments in both State and Federal appellate courts. In 2014 and 2015, Ashley was named a South Carolina Rising Star Lawyer, an honor reserved for less than 2.5% of all attorneys in South Carolina. Before joining McGowan, Hood, Felder & Phillips, LLC, she worked as an associate with Nelson Mullins Riley & Scarborough for several years, focusing mainly on product liability cases. Ashley is a board member of the South Carolina Association for Justice and teaches Sunday School at her church. In her spare time Ashley enjoys spending time with her husband, children, and dog; cooking; reading; and attempting to paddleboard.

Mandy Pittman is an associate in the Columbia office where she focuses on medical malpractice, nursing home, and personal injury cases. Before joining the team at McGowan, Hood, Felder & Phillips, Mandy practiced at an insurance defense/subrogation firm and then at a personal injury firm where, in 2019, she earned the title of one of Midlands Legal Elite in the area of Personal Injury. She has also been recognized as one of Best Lawyers' "Ones to Watch" in 2020 and 2022. Mandy is involved in numerous legal organizations. Within the South Carolina Bar, Mandy serves on the Professional Responsibility and Ethics Advisory Committees. She is also very involved in the Richland County Bar where she serves as the chair of the Membership Committee and also serves on the Wellness and Diversity Committees. Mandy is a member of the John Belton O'Neall Inn of Court where is currently serving as the Webmaster. Finally, Mandy is a member of the South Carolina Association for Justice and the Academy of Truck Accident Attorneys. A small-town girl at heart, Mandy grew up in Lugoff, South Carolina. After graduating from Lugoff-Elgin High School, Mandy attended Presbyterian College, where she was inducted into three academic honor societies: Sigma Kappa Alpha, Phi Alpha Theta, and Sigma Tau Delta. She then attended the University of South Carolina School of Law where she was an active member of the Mock Trial Bar and received a CALI award in three courses - Problems in Professional Responsibility, Advanced Legal Writing, and Sales. A CALI award signifies that a student earned the highest grade out of every student in the course. On a personal note, Mandy is a South Carolina "Ultimate Outsider," meaning she has visited all 47 state parks. When she is not hiking or exploring, Mandy enjoys putting together jigsaw puzzles, spending time with family, and attending Calvary Baptist Church. Practice Areas Medical Malpractice

Donovan was born and raised in Hartsville, South Carolina. He attended the public schools of Darlington County, graduating from Hartsville High School in 2009. After playing football for two years at South Carolina State University, Donovan later graduated from the University of South Carolina in 2014 with a Bachelor of Arts degree in Political Science. Immediately after graduation, he began working in the Lieutenant Governor of South Carolina's office as the executive assistant to Yancey McGill and Henry McMaster. During his tenure, he worked specifically on projects which focused on bringing resources to the elderly. After spending a couple of years working in state government, Donovan realized that he wanted to continue his quest of serving the rural areas by attending law school. Donovan graduated from the University of South Carolina School of Law in 2019. While in law school, he was active in the Matthew Perry Chapter of the Black Law Students Association and an active member of the American Constitution Society. Donovan also worked in the Governor's office under Henry McMaster as his law clerk and staff member throughout his law school career. In 2021, Donovan was part of the legal team which reached a landmark settlement of $88 million for the Charleston Nine. This settlement is believed to be the largest civil rights settlement for individual cases in US History. We invite you to read more about how justice was served for the victims and survivors. Donovan is a lifelong member of Jerusalem Baptist Church in Hartsville, South Carolina. He is also an active member of Omega Psi Phi Fraternity, Incorporated. When not in the office, Donovan enjoys playing and watching sports, cooking and spending time with his family and goldendoodle, Shiloh.

McGowan, Hood, Felder & Phillips started with three attorneys - Chad McGowan, S. Randall Hood and Johnny Felder - who believed that every South Carolina client deserved to be treated with respect, and that every person in need deserved an opportunity to tell their story. Since then, we have grown in size and number, with nearly 20 attorneys whose primary goal is offer you and your family exceptional legal guidance and support when most needed. We have opened multiple offices throughout South Carolina, because we know that traveling can be difficult for some of our clients. In this way, we help make ourselves more accessible to you when you need us, and help build our ties in the communities we love.
